Not only is he the best rapper in the hip-hop game. He also is one of most successful entrepreneurs to date. He has countless business ventures from his part ownership of the NBA team New Jersey Nets. His urban clothing line Rocawear. A chain of sports bars called the 40/40 club and he is the co-brand director for Budweiser Select. There are many more business ventures he is involved in which have made him worth an estimated $150 million.

That is why you must respect his conglomerate because he has business ventures in many different areas.
